Remove auxiliary equipment such as tractors and generators.

PowerCELL allows for the remote restarting of pumps for the next stage and the removal of tractors, reducing trips into the high-pressure RED ZONE, improving site layout, and increasing usable space by 30%.

PowerCELL Field Integration

The PowerCELL system seamlessly integrates with any frac spread via a simple plug-and-play installation.

Typical field deployments use a daisy chain hydraulic set-up. Full remote capabilities can be achieved allowing frac pumps to be started remotely.

  • No modifications to existing assets are required, including dual-fuel fleets.

  • Hydraulic capabilities can be expanded and include pump-down units.
